Your Hewlett Packard HDX Premium Notebook Series X16-1000 CTO supports up to 8 in 2 slots and modules must be installed 1 at a time.

Install in matched pairs to utilize Dual Channel mode. Installing more than 4GB of memory will require a 64-bit Operating System.
